Warning Signs You Need Skylight Leak Water Removal

Ignoring warning signs of a skylight leak can lead to costly repairs down the line. Keep an eye out for these red flags: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ors in your home can show the presence of mold and mildew. Don’t ignore these signs, call us to schedule an inspection and removal service today.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Visible water stains or discoloration on your ceilings and walls are clear indicators of a skylight leak. Don’t wait, call us to schedule a repair service and prevent further damage.

Sagging Ceilings and Floors

Water damage can cause ceilings and floors to sag, leading to a host of other issues. Don’t risk further damage, call us to schedule a repair service today.

Unexplained Molds and Mildew

Mold and mildew growth can be a symptom of a larger water damage issue. Don’t ignore these signs, call us to schedule an inspection and removal service today.

Peeling Paint and Wallpaper

Water damage can cause paint and wallpaper to peel and flake. Don’t let these signs slip by, call us to schedule a repair service today.

Water Damage Under Flooring

Water damage can seep under flooring, causing warping and buckling. Don’t risk further damage, call us to schedule a repair service today.

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ost in Decatur, TX

The cost of skylight leak water removal in Decatur, TX,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for skylight leak water removal services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,000 Severity and size of affected area
Standing Water Removal $1,000 – $5,000 Volume of water and equ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Repair and Restoration $2,000 – $10,000 Extent of damage and materials needed
Final Inspections and Cleanup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and equipment needed

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and can vary depending on the specifics of your situation. We’ll provide a free, no-obligation consultation to assess the damage and provide a personalized estimate for your skylight leak water removal needs.

What is the best way to prevent skylight leaks?

The best way to prevent skylight leaks is to maintain regular inspections and maintenance of your skylight, including cleaning the glass and seals, and checking for any signs of damage or wear.
